POF -
Radiantech, Inc.
POF (Plastic Optical Fiber) is a new, convenient, effective, and economical method to construct optical networks at small office or home. A visible red light of 650 nm is utilized in this application so users can easily see the light at the cutting edge of the POF. Major application here is 100Mbps Fast Ethernet over POF implemented by distinct media converter or switches.

OS417 -
Advanced Fiber Solutions
The OS417 is optimized for POF (Plastic Optical Fiber) and larger core multimode applications. The OS417 has two fixed ST active device mount LEDs with transmitting wavelengths of 665nm and 850nm.
